titleOfInvention Method for assessing effectiveness of dialysis therapy accompanying detoxification
abstract FIELD: medicine. n SUBSTANCE: invention refers to a method for assessing the effectiveness of dialysis therapy accompanying detoxification consists in the fact that 2-4 hours after administering a dialysis solution, the latter is sampled from the abdominal cavity; dialysis solution samples are prepared to be analysed by wedge dehydration and microscopically examined in usual light to detect a sodium chloride crystal structure. If perpendicular linear crystal fragments appear to prevail, the dialysis therapy is considered to be inadequate; radial crystal fragments enables stating the dialysis therapy to be corrected, whereas separate crystal fragments arranged chaotically makes it possible to consider the dialysis therapy adequate. n EFFECT: using the declared method enables providing higher effectiveness of assessing the dialysis therapy accompanying detoxification. n 3 dwg, 3 ex
